Shriya is a feminine name of Sanskrit origin, predominantly used in Hindu culture. The name is derived from the Sanskrit word 'श्री' (Shri), which translates to 'radiance,' 'splendor,' or 'prosperity.' In Hindu tradition, Shri is also an honorific title used to show respect and is often associated with Lakshmi, the goddess of wealth and prosperity.
The name Shriya carries significant cultural and religious connotations in Indian heritage. It embodies qualities of auspiciousness, divine beauty, and grace. The addition of the suffix 'ya' to 'Shri' enhances the feminine quality of the name while maintaining its connection to concepts of light and divine blessing. Throughout history, the name has remained popular among Hindu families seeking to bestow qualities of prosperity and divine grace upon their daughters.
Shriya is a feminine name with roots in Sanskrit, traditionally used in Indian culture. While the name appears in both American and British records, it hasn't ranked among the top names in either country's official statistics, suggesting it remains relatively uncommon in Western countries.
Despite not achieving mainstream popularity in the US or UK, Shriya has gained recognition through cultural exchange and globalization. The name, which typically means "prosperity," "fortune," or "beauty" in its original context, has gradually found its way into multicultural communities. Its elegant sound and meaningful origins continue to attract parents seeking names with cultural significance and unique character.
The name Shriya, with its melodious sound and spiritual significance, has gained popularity across various cultures, particularly in South Asia. While the standard spelling is Shriya, several variants exist based on transliteration differences and regional pronunciations. Common spelling variants include Shreya, Sriya, and Shreeya, all maintaining the same essential pronunciation but adapting to different linguistic conventions. In India, the Sanskrit-derived variant Shriyaa emphasizes the elongated final vowel, while the simplified form Srija is sometimes used in southern regions. International adaptations sometimes appear as Shreea or the anglicized Shria, allowing for easier pronunciation in Western countries while preserving the name's cultural essence.
Beyond formal variants, Shriya lends itself to numerous affectionate nicknames used by family and friends. The diminutive Shri (pronounced 'Shree') serves as the most common nickname, elegant in its simplicity. Other popular nicknames include Riya, which emphasizes the latter portion of the name, and Shri-Shri, commonly used for children. Some families opt for Iya or Eeya as endearing pet names, while others use Shree or the playful Shriyali, adding a suffix to create a more intimate form. Among English-speaking friends, nicknames like Shree-bear or Shri-Shri might emerge, blending cultural elements with Western nicknaming conventions. Each variant and nickname retains the name's fundamental meaning of 'radiance' or 'prosperity' while allowing for personalization and cultural adaptability.
